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ION AGENCY

[ER-FRL-6643-2]

 
Environmental Impact Statements and Regulations; Availability of 
EPA Comments

    Availability of EPA comments prepared pursuant to the Environmental 
Review Process (ERP), under Section 309 of the Clean Air Act and 
Section 102(2)(c) of the National Environmental Policy Act as amended. 
Requests for copies of EPA comments can be directed to the Office of 
Federal Activities at (202) 564-7167.
    An explanation of the ratings assigned to draft environmental 
impact statements (EISs) was published in FR dated April 4, 2003 (68 FR 
16511).

Draft EISs

    ERP No. D-AFS-J70021-SD Rating EC2, Prairie Project Area (Lower 
Rapid Creek Area), Multiple Resource Management Actions, 
Implementation, Black Hills National Forest, Mystic Ranger District, 
Pennington County, ID.
    Summary: EPA has environmental concerns about potential soil 
erosion, runoff and degradation of water quality and stream habitat, 
stream sedimentation, and impacts to wildlife and sensitive species. 
EPA recommended the final EIS include measures to minimize impacts to 
important wildlife habitat and private property when harvesting on the 
Forest Service-private land interface.

    ERP No. D-FHW-F40413-IL Rating EC2, US 20 (FAP 301) Construction 
Project, IL-84 north of Galena to Bolton Road northwest of Freeport, 
Funding, NPDES Permit and U.S. Army COE Section 404 Permit Issuance, Jo 
Davies and Stephenson Counties, IL.
    Summary: EPA has environmental concerns with the proposed project 
relating to: (1) Karst areas and groundwater contamination, (2) 
impaired water impacts, (3) neotropical migrant impacts, and (4) forest 
impact mitigation.
    ERP No. D-FHW-F40414-OH Rating EC2, Butler County, OH-63 Extension 
to U.S. 127 (Trenton Area Access), Construction of a Multi-Lane Limited 
Access, Divided Highway on New Alignment from east of OH-41/OH-63 
Interchange in the City of Monroe, Funding, Butler County, OH.
    Summary: EPA has environmental concerns with the proposed project 
regarding potential ground water contamination in a federally-
designated sole source aquifer (the Great Miami/Little Miami Buried 
Valley Aquifer System). EPA also asks that more information be provided 
on wetlands mitigation and impacts to surface water.
    ERP No. D-FHW-F40415-IN Rating EC2, US 31 Improvement Project (I-
465 to IN-38) between I-465 North Leg and IN-38, Funding, NPDES Permit 
and U.S. Army Section 10 and 404 Permits Issuance, Hamilton County, IN.
    Summary: EPA has environmental concerns with the preferred 
alternative regarding potentially adverse impacts to public drinking 
water supplies, forests, wetlands, streams and floodplains. EPA 
recommends the FEIS include specific mitigation measures to minimize 
and/or compensate for these impacts.

    ERP No. D-NPS-J65384-MT Rating EC2, Glacier National Park 
Commercial Services Plan, and General Management Plan, Implementation, 
Glacier National Park, a Portion of Waterton-Glacier International 
Peace Park, Flathead and Glacier Counties, MT.
    Summary: EPA expressed environmental concerns with potential 
impacts to outstanding resource waters within Glacier National Park 
from stream channel maintenance activities and construction. EPA 
believes additional information should be presented to fully assess and 
mitigate all potential impacts of the management actions.

    ERP No. F-DOE-L08063-WA, Plymouth Generating Facility, Construction 
and Operation of a 307-megawatt (MW) Natural Gas-Fired Combined Cycle 
Power Generation Facility on a 44.5 Acre Site, Conditional Use/Special 
Use Permit Issuance, Benton County, WA.
    Summary: EPA continues to have environmental concerns with the lack 
of a comprehensive air quality cumulative effects analysis.
    ERP No. F-FHW-K40253-CA, Riverside County Integrated Project, 
Winchester to Temecula Corridor, Construction of a New Multi-Modal 
Transportation Facility, Route Location and Right-of-Way Preservation, 
Riverside County, CA.
    Summary: EPA has environmental concerns regarding the preferred 
alternative's contribution to habitat fragmentation, and impacts to 
endangered species, waters of the United States, water quality and air 
quality. EPA requests clarifications in the Record of Decision, and 
commitments that these key issues be addressed in the Tier 2 project 
level evaluation.
